The Defense Logistics Agency awarded a delivery order under contract SPE8ES24D0005 to ASRC FEDERAL FACILITIES LOGISTICS (CAGE 79343) for the procurement of an Epoxy Primer Coating Kit, identified by NSN 8010016712313, at a total price of $121.14. The award was issued on July 31, 2026, with delivery required by August 10, 2026, to the designated destination at Fort Campbell, Kentucky. The order consists of a single line item with no options or quantity variances, and the contract value is fixed. Transportation is governed by FOB destination terms, with the contractor responsible for all freight costs and required to use the fastest traceable shipping method, explicitly excluding parcel post. The shipment must be marked with the TCN W50YER62120090, DIC A0A, and the full destination address, though no specific labeling requirements for NSN, lot number, or handling symbols are provided. Packaging and preservation standards are not detailed, nor are any MIL-STD references explicitly cited. Inspection and acceptance occur at the destination, with government authority holding final acceptance. Terms and conditions are incorporated by reference from prior contract SPE8EG-19-D-0103, while agency-specific transportation codes S8EF and S9NA are used in lieu of standard FAR clauses. No evaluation factors, representations, certifications, or contract administration contacts are listed, and the award appears to follow a Lowest Price Technically Acceptable approach consistent with simplified acquisition procedures for low-value, standardized supplies. The NAICS code 325510 indicates classification under Paint and Coating Manufacturing, and no socioeconomic set-aside information is provided. Invoicing, payment office details, and specific technical specifications for the coating kit are not included in the documentation.

Solicitation SPE8ES-26-T-2760 is a fixed-price request for quotations issued by DLA Troop Support Construction and Equipment for the procurement of four rain erosion resisting coating kits, identified by NSN 8010013153897. Each kit must consist of Parts A and B to produce 0.946 liters of gray coating in accordance with FED-STD-595 color number 36176. The items are designated as Type 2 Code 4 with an extendable shelf life of 12 months and must be stored in original unopened containers at temperatures between 70 and 100 degrees Fahrenheit. Delivery is required within 32 days of award, with a final required delivery date of January 10, 2027, shipped FOB Destination to DLA Distribution San Joaquin in Tracy, California. The contract mandates strict adherence to MIL-STD-2073-1E for packaging and MIL-STD-129 for marking, including the use of Special Marking Code 33. Packaging options include the use of D3 or 4G boxes, E6 boxes, or specific bonding methods for cans, and all kits must include an itemized list of contents. Because the materials are hazardous, suppliers must provide Safety Data Sheets and labels conforming to the OSHA Hazard Communication Standard and 29 CFR 1910.1200. Administrative requirements include the use of the Wide Area WorkFlow system for invoicing and compliance with the Buy American Act, the Berry Amendment, and DFARS 252.204-7012 for safeguarding covered defense information. Inspection and acceptance will take place at the destination.
